Medtronic is one of the largest medical device manufacturers in the world, founded in a Minneapolis garage in 1949 as a repair shop for hospital equipment before building the first wearable cardiac pacemaker. Its portfolio now spans cardiac rhythm devices, heart valves, neuromodulation and neurosurgery, surgical stapling and robotics, spinal implants and diabetes management systems sold in more than one hundred and fifty countries. The company is legally domiciled in Ireland after its 2015 combination with Covidien, while its operational headquarters and most of its research remain in Minnesota.

A Day in the Life

The Business Development Manager is responsible for driving sustainable business growth, portfolio expansion, and strategic initiatives across Vietnam. This role leads business development, commercial transformation, market access, and stakeholder engagement efforts to accelerate therapy adoption, improve profitability, and support Medtronic's long-term growth ambitions.
